How Far From Essondale to ...
We spend a lot of time looking through Gazetteers that were published in the late 1800's and early 1900's. Many of the Gazetteers include the distance from a community such as Essondale to various places of note, such as Parliament Hill.
With a nod to our favorite Gazetteers, the straight-line distance<1> beginning in Essondale and extending to:
- Victoria, which is the Provincial Capital of British Columbia, lies 60 miles [96.6 km]<1> to the south southwest (SSW). If you could walk a straight line from Essondale to Victoria, with an average speed<2> of 2.2 miles [3.5 km] per hour, it would take most of three days to make the trip. A horse and buggy averaging 3.2 miles [5.1 km] per hour would take about three full days.
- The National Capital at Parliament Hill (Ottawa, ON) is 2,184 miles [3,514.8 km] to the east (E). Driving, with an average speed of 63 miles [101.4 km] per hour, would take 5 days, a buggy would take 86 days and walking would take 124 days.
- The shortest distance<3> to Jerusalem (specifically the Temple Mount and the Dome of the Rock) is 6,674 miles [10,740.8 km] and it lies to the north northeast (NNE).<4>
- The distance to the Great Mosque of Mecca (specifically the Ka'bah - or Kaaba ) is 7,434 miles [11,963.9 km] and it lies to the north northeast (NNE).<5>
- The distance to Saint Peter's Basilica (The Vatican) is 5,576 miles [8,973.7 km] and it lies to the north northeast (NNE).<6>'

| <3> | The shortest line can be visualized by stretching a string on a Globe from Point A to Point B - this is known as a Great Circle Route. Where you might expect the shortest route from Essondale to the Middle East to be East and South, the Great Circle Route actually lies to the North and East.Our distance measurements begin at a specific point in Essondale.
